Quiz 5 Score: \( 4 / 9 \) Answered: \( 5 / 9 \) Question 6 Subtract and simplify the answer. If your answer is an improper fraction, rewrite it as a mixed numb \( \frac{53}{24}-\frac{20}{24} \)

Solution

To subtract the fractions, first notice that they have the same denominator:   53/24 - 20/24 = (53 - 20)/24 = 33/24 Now, simplify the fraction 33/24 by dividing the numerator and denominator by their greatest common factor, which is 3:   33 ÷ 3 = 11   24 ÷ 3 = 8 So, 33/24 simplifies to 11/8. Since the answer is an improper fraction, convert it into a mixed number. Divide the numerator by the denominator:   11 ÷ 8 = 1 remainder 3 Thus, 11/8 = 1 3/8. The final answer is 1 3/8.

When you subtract the fractions \( \frac{53}{24} - \frac{20}{24} \), you simply subtract the numerators while keeping the denominator the same. This gives you: \[ \frac{53 - 20}{24} = \frac{33}{24} \] Now, to simplify \( \frac{33}{24} \), you can see that both the numerator and denominator can be divided by 3. This gives: \[ \frac{33 \div 3}{24 \div 3} = \frac{11}{8} \] Since \( \frac{11}{8} \) is an improper fraction (the numerator is larger than the denominator), you can convert it into a mixed number. Divide 11 by 8, which goes 1 time, with a remainder of 3. So, it can be expressed as: \[ 1 \frac{3}{8} \] Final answer: \( 1 \frac{3}{8} \)
